Description

This book offers a comprehensive and practical guide to developing and implementing clear strategies for ensuring best practice clinical governance in health services. Present and future healthcare leaders, health boards, executive teams, and clinician leaders can use this as a personal and instructional guide in building, monitoring, and improving the clinical governance systems that underpin their organizations.
